Christmas came to NYC’s Rockefeller Plaza a month early when Justin Bieber hit the outdoor stage on the “Today” show to perform songs off his Christmas album Under the Mistletoe. The teen idol warmed up the freezing stage by bringing out Usher to cover the holiday classic “The Christmas Song (Chestnuts Roasting on an Open Fire).”

Following the performance, Ursh addressed the recent claims from a woman who says Bieber fathered her child. “A lot of it comes with the territory. Popularity makes you a target,” said the music industry vet. “We’re focusing on more positive things. This year, having the first No. 1 Christmas album ever, it’s a great accomplishment. That speaks to the world, no matter what negativity comes your way, there’s always something positive there.”

The Biebs also premiered the video for “Fa La La,” a duet with his childhood idols Boyz II Men. Watch both below.
